It's a problem that parents never want to face: the serious illness of their child. But during the week of May 24, it's a problem that DAYS OF OUR LIVES' Jack and Jennifer Deveraux must face head on. While attending a party, the couple receive the frantic news that baby Abigail's temperature has spiked. The nervous parents race Abby to University Hospital, the first of several trips during the infant's serious illness.
"It's going to be a very realistic story, a very personal story that's going to cause strain and be a time of bonding for Jack and Jennifer," promises headwriter Jim Reilly. "Abby will seem to be well for awhile and then sick again, back to the hospital for a few more days. It's going to be like a rollercoaster."
Reilly adds that the storyline will delve into each of the characters and how they respond to the crisis. Jack and Jennifer both have been fighting to get their careers on track the past few months, but their efforts may have to be put on hold because of Abby's illness.
"I think that we have to examine where they came from in their past lives," says Reilly. "Jennifer is someone who was brought up in the warm Horton family. She has a very strong family that she could always rely on. Jack was the adopted son of a powerful man, he lost his brother Patch, both of his fathers and his sister left town. Basically he's a man alone, and I think the way that Jack deals with a crisis and the fear that he's going to lose Abby is to almost go into denial. When he's faced with something that he can't control, he denies that it's going to happen. In order for him not to be hurt, he withdraws and builds layers of protection over him."
Actor Matthew Ashford perhaps knows Jack inside and out, and says that denial is really the character's modus operandi. "The idea of losing something and not being able to control the situation is very frightening to him. We never really played through the thing of him losing Patch. So here's the chance of another blood relation that could just go away like everyone else. I think that this will bring out in Jack something other than protecting and making sure that someone has something. Finally there's the chance of losing something that you can't buy or put a dollar sign on."
While Jack has been known to run from his problems, Jennifer is the exact opposite and chooses to delve into the problem. "I think that she will stop the career and everything else to help Abby," surmises Melissa Reeves. "She's been able to work and have a career because she knows that Abby is healthy and being taken care of by good people. But once a tragedy like this happens, I think that the career will just stop. Having a baby makes you a mother bar and the baby will come first."
The sadness of Abigail's illness is thankfully not mirrored in reality by Ashford and Reeves, who both have very healthy toddlers at home. Reeves, though, shares a real-life experience from which she hopes to draw her motivation: "When Emily was three weeks old, we were at Scott's work and she choked on some liquid vitamins. Her whole body went limp. We ran out of the dressing room, ran down to the lobby and called an ambulance. I was completely freaked out. I was shaking, crying. Maybe I freaked out because Scott was there, and I think that Jennifer will be really scared because she knows that Jack's there as well. If he wasn't there, Jennifer would probably really have to keep a handle on things. But I think that she's going to be very upset."
"You are going to find both Jack and Jennifer facing this in different ways, and we'll see how their marriage and relationship makes it through this conflict," says Reilly. "Sometimes when the crisis is over, the marriage is stronger because of the bond between them. Sometimes the bond has gotten weaker. Whatever happens, it's going to happen in a very realistic way with these two."
Reeves, however, believes that adversity will only bring the couple closer together. "I think that maybe in a situation like that, Jack and Jennifer would put aside their selfish differences and really think of the baby more than anything," she says. "I know that there's tension created by the whole situation and that could cause some problems, but hopefully we can put that aside."
DAYS OF OUR LIVES fans are hoping that the couple can withstand this new obstacle as well, but Reilly teases that shocking developments are ahead: "The story is going to have a definite effect on what they do and what happens to them individual and together. There are twists and turns and surprises which will affect their careers. At the end of the line there will be two major reveals that will affect the Hortons as a family, Jennifer personally. . .and we'll also see a big growth and maturation of Jack."
